>> The short answer is that jig does not officially work in JHS. 
>> 
>> The longer answer is that I have a version that will work, but it disrupts 
>> the REPL of the IDE as it produces SVG output instead of HTML. For jqt the 
>> output is contained in a separate window, so the SVG is isolated.
>> 
>> I am planning a update for j901 in jqt when it comes out of beta. 
>> Unfortunately, the addon system does not support multiple J versions at the 
>> same time. This means that the new version will work very well in J901, but 
>> will not display as cleanly in j807 etc.
